Welcome to Day 2 of Event #53: $3,000 Limit Hold'em 6-Handed

Jesse Martin - Going for 2nd Win of the Summer
Jesse Martin - Going for 2nd Win of the Summer

Day 2 of Event #53: $3,000 Limit Hold'em 6-Handed is scheduled to begin at 2:00 p.m. local time with 73 players returning from the 256 players who started Day 1.

Juha Helppi leads the field with 146,000 chips. Not far behind are Justin Thurlow (100,000), David Bach (99,500) and Ayaz Mahmood (85,500). Meanwhile two-time bracelet winner Jesse Martin (78,000) is currently seventh in chips and looking for his second bracelet of the summer.

The payouts begin at 39th place which puts them 34 players from the money, so they still need to lose about half the field to see the first payout of $4,482.

The action gets underway at the start of Level 11 with blinds at 800/1,500 and limits at 1,500/3,000. There will be 10 levels of play today with a 15-minute break at the end of every two levels and a 60-minute dinner break at the end of the sixth level (~8:30 p.m.).

Frank Kassela Eliminated in 16th Place ($7,821)

Level 17 : 6,000/12,000, 0 ante
Frank Kassela
Frank Kassela

Frank Kassela lost seemingly every hand he played when coming back from dinner break. He was disappointed that he folded a big hand after building a huge pot four ways heading to the flop.

On his final hand, Ayman Qutami raised, and Kassela three-bet. Mickey Craft four-bet from the small blind, and Kassela was the lone caller.

The flop came {10-Hearts}{9-Clubs}{4-Spades}, and Craft bet. Kassela raised all in, and Craft called with {j-}{j-}. Kassela showed {k-}{q-} and asked the dealer to give Craft a set, which would give Kassela a straight.

The turn was the {8-Hearts} and the river was the {q-Hearts}, and Craft won the hand with a straight. Kassela was eliminated in 16th place and will take home ($7,821).

Jesse Martin Eliminated in 15th Place ($7,821)

Level 17 : 6,000/12,000, 0 ante
Jesse Martin
Jesse Martin

Jesse Martin was eliminated after a series of hands that eventually sent him to the rail in 15th place.

He got three bets in preflop with Max Silver and the flop came {9-Hearts}{8-Clubs}{3-Clubs}. Silver bet and Martin called. The turn was the {9-Diamonds} and both players checked. The river was the {a-Diamonds} and Silver led. Martin called, leaving only 15,000 behind. Silver won the hand with queens, {q-Clubs}{q-Spades}.

The next hand, David Olson eliminated Martin with {k-}{j-} when he flopped top pair. Martin will take home $7,821.

Ayaz Mahmood Eliminated in 12th Place ($9,775)

Level 18 : 8,000/16,000, 0 ante
Ayaz Mahmood
Ayaz Mahmood

Ayaz Mahmood got all in against Georgios Kapalas. Kapalas had {a-}{9-} versus the {8-}{8-} of Mahmood.

Mahmood held until the bitter end when the {a-Diamonds} came on the river and gave Kapalas the best hand and sent Mahmood to the rail.

Mahmood came into today with the third biggest stack and parlayed that into a deep Day 2 run, but ultimately was unable to push beyond 12th place.

David Bach Eliminated in 11th Place ($9,775)

Level 18 : 8,000/16,000, 0 ante
David Bach
David Bach

David Bach became one of the shorter stacks and eventually would bust when Mickey Craft rivered a straight.

Bach and Craft were heads up to the {q-Clubs}{j-Diamonds}{8-Spades} flop and Bach check-raised all in. Craft called. Bach had {k-}{j-} against the {10-Clubs}{8-Clubs} of Craft.

Once they were both all in, the turn came the {6-Clubs} and the river was the {9-}, giving Craft a straight. Bach was eliminated in 11th place.
